REA Holdings Unit In Phased Land Swap Deal With Coal Miner

5th Feb 2014 10:07

LONDON (Alliance News) - Palm Oil producer REA Holdings PLC Wednesday said its PT Sasana Yudha Bhakti subsidiary has reached a land swap deal meaning it can plant palms on land currently owned by PT Praesetia Utama, while that company will be able to start coal mining on land owned by PT Sasana Yudha Bhakti.

In a statement, REA Holdings said the deal is for a phased land swap allowing the development of blocks of land. One a critical mass of oil palm is established on the PT Praesetia Utama land, then the full land swap deal will take place and ownership of the land covered by the deal transferred.

It said the phased deal will allow it to make sure that the land titles held by PT Praesetia Utama remain valid before the whole deal is completed.

REA Holdings shared last traded at 462.5 pence in London.
